项目化管理的模式有哪些

项目化管理的模式有哪些

项目化管理的模式主要包括:传统瀑布式管理、敏捷管理、混合管理、极限编程(XP)、看板管理。 传统瀑布式管理模式是最经典的项目管理方法,适用于需求明确且变动较少的项目。敏捷管理模式则更适用于需求不断变化的项目,通过短周期的迭代实现快速交付。混合管理模式结合了瀑布式和敏捷的优点,适用于复杂的项目。极限编程(XP)强调高质量代码和客户满意度。看板管理则通过可视化工具帮助团队优化工作流程和资源配置。

传统瀑布式管理模式 是一种线性且顺序的项目管理方法,项目按预定的阶段逐步推进,每个阶段都有明确的开始和结束点。这种模式强调计划和规范,每一个阶段的输出都是下一个阶段的输入,适用于需求非常明确且变动较少的项目。由于其结构性和可预测性,瀑布式管理在建筑、制造等领域应用广泛。然而,其缺点也显而易见:在项目进行中如果需求发生变更,调整起来非常困难且成本高昂。

一、传统瀑布式管理

瀑布式管理的定义和特点

瀑布式管理是一种线性项目管理方法,项目按预定的阶段逐步推进,每个阶段都有明确的开始和结束点。其核心特点包括计划和规范性强、阶段性明确、输出作为下一阶段的输入

  1. 计划和规范性强:瀑布式管理强调详细的规划和规范,各个阶段的任务和目标必须在项目开始前明确。
  2. 阶段性明确:项目按顺序分为需求分析、设计、开发、测试和维护等阶段,每个阶段都有明确的目标和任务。
  3. 输出作为下一阶段的输入:每个阶段的输出结果将作为下一阶段的输入,这使得项目进展具有较强的依赖性。

瀑布式管理的优缺点

优点

  • 计划性强:详细的前期规划使得项目进展有条不紊。
  • 可预测性高:由于每个阶段都有明确的任务和目标,项目的进展和结果相对可预测。
  • 文档规范:每个阶段的文档和输出明确,使得项目管理和交接更加容易。

缺点

  • 灵活性差:一旦项目进入某个阶段,变更需求将会导致较高的成本和时间消耗。
  • 风险集中:由于需求在项目初期就被完全确定,中途的需求变更可能导致项目失败。
  • 反馈滞后:用户反馈只能在项目的后期进行,难以及时调整。

二、敏捷管理

敏捷管理的定义和特点

敏捷管理是一种迭代和增量的项目管理方法,强调快速交付和持续改进。其核心特点包括迭代开发、持续交付、客户参与

  1. 迭代开发:项目被分为多个短周期的迭代,每个迭代都包含需求分析、设计、开发、测试等环节。
  2. 持续交付:每个迭代结束后,都会交付可用的产品版本,从而实现持续交付。
  3. 客户参与:客户在每个迭代中都参与需求评审和反馈,确保产品满足客户需求。

敏捷管理的优缺点

优点

  • 灵活性高:能够快速响应需求变更,降低项目风险。
  • 客户满意度高:通过持续交付和客户反馈,确保产品满足客户需求。
  • 团队协作:强调团队的跨职能协作和自组织,提高团队效率。

缺点

  • 前期规划不足:由于强调快速迭代,前期的详细规划可能不够充分。
  • 文档不规范:由于快速迭代,文档的规范性可能不足,影响后期维护。
  • 依赖团队能力:敏捷管理对团队的自组织能力要求较高,如果团队能力不足,项目可能难以推进。

三、混合管理

混合管理的定义和特点

混合管理模式结合了传统瀑布式管理和敏捷管理的优点,适用于复杂和需求多变的项目。其核心特点包括阶段性规划、迭代执行、灵活应变

  1. 阶段性规划:在项目的初期进行详细的阶段性规划,确保项目的整体方向和目标明确。
  2. 迭代执行:在每个阶段内部,采用敏捷的迭代方法,确保快速交付和持续改进。
  3. 灵活应变:在项目的进行过程中,根据需求的变更和反馈,灵活调整项目计划和执行方法。

混合管理的优缺点

优点

  • 综合优势:结合了瀑布式管理的计划性和敏捷管理的灵活性,适用于复杂项目。
  • 风险可控:通过阶段性规划和迭代执行,将项目风险分散到各个阶段。
  • 高效交付:在确保项目整体方向不变的前提下,通过迭代实现快速交付。

缺点

  • 复杂性高:由于结合了两种管理方法,项目管理的复杂性增加。
  • 需求不确定性:在需求不明确或频繁变更的情况下,可能会导致项目进展不顺。
  • 团队要求高:对团队的管理能力和执行能力要求较高。

四、极限编程(XP)

极限编程的定义和特点

极限编程(XP)是一种强调高质量代码和客户满意度的敏捷开发方法。其核心特点包括持续集成、测试驱动开发(TDD)、结对编程

  1. 持续集成:代码在提交后立即进行自动化测试和集成,确保代码的高质量和稳定性。
  2. 测试驱动开发(TDD):在编写代码前先编写测试用例,确保代码在开发过程中通过所有测试。
  3. 结对编程:两名开发人员共同编写代码,一人编写代码,另一人进行代码评审,提高代码质量和团队协作。

极限编程的优缺点

优点

  • 代码质量高:通过持续集成和测试驱动开发,确保代码的高质量和稳定性。
  • 客户满意度高:强调客户参与和需求反馈,确保产品满足客户需求。
  • 团队协作:通过结对编程和团队评审,提高团队协作和代码质量。

缺点

  • 学习曲线陡峭:极限编程对团队的技术能力和协作能力要求较高,团队需要一定的学习和适应时间。
  • 适用性有限:极限编程适用于小型团队和高技术含量的项目,不适用于大型和复杂项目。
  • 资源投入高:结对编程和持续集成需要较高的资源投入,可能增加项目成本。

五、看板管理

看板管理的定义和特点

看板管理是一种通过可视化工具帮助团队优化工作流程和资源配置的项目管理方法。其核心特点包括可视化工作流程、限制在制品(WIP)、持续改进

  1. 可视化工作流程:通过看板工具,将工作流程和任务状态可视化,帮助团队了解项目进展和任务分配。
  2. 限制在制品(WIP):限制同时进行的任务数量,确保团队专注于当前任务,提高工作效率。
  3. 持续改进:通过定期评审和反馈,不断优化工作流程和资源配置,提高团队效率和项目质量。

看板管理的优缺点

优点

  • 透明度高:通过可视化工具,团队和项目管理者可以清晰了解项目进展和任务状态。
  • 灵活性强:看板管理能够快速响应需求变更和资源调整,提高项目灵活性。
  • 效率高:通过限制在制品和持续改进,优化工作流程和资源配置,提高团队效率。

缺点

  • 依赖工具:看板管理依赖于可视化工具和数据,可能增加项目管理的复杂性。
  • 适用性有限:看板管理适用于中小型团队和项目,不适用于大型和复杂项目。
  • 变更管理难:在需求频繁变更的情况下,可能会导致看板工具和数据的不准确,影响项目管理效果。

六、项目管理系统推荐

在项目化管理中,选择合适的项目管理系统至关重要。以下是两个推荐的项目管理系统:

研发项目管理系统PingCode

PingCode是一个专为研发团队设计的项目管理系统,提供了一系列强大的工具和功能,帮助团队高效管理项目和任务。其核心功能包括迭代管理、需求管理、缺陷管理、版本管理、资源管理

  1. 迭代管理:支持敏捷开发的迭代管理,帮助团队进行迭代计划和跟踪。
  2. 需求管理:支持需求的收集、分析和管理,确保项目满足客户需求。
  3. 缺陷管理:提供缺陷跟踪和管理工具,帮助团队快速发现和解决问题。
  4. 版本管理:支持版本控制和发布管理,确保项目的高质量和稳定性。
  5. 资源管理:提供资源分配和管理工具,优化团队资源配置。

通用项目管理软件Worktile

Worktile是一款通用的项目管理软件,适用于各种类型的项目和团队。其核心功能包括任务管理、时间管理、文档管理、团队协作、报表分析

  1. 任务管理:提供任务分配、跟踪和管理工具,帮助团队高效完成任务。
  2. 时间管理:支持时间计划和跟踪,帮助团队合理安排工作时间。
  3. 文档管理:提供文档存储和管理工具,确保项目文档的安全和规范。
  4. 团队协作:支持团队沟通和协作工具,提升团队协作效率。
  5. 报表分析:提供项目报表和数据分析工具,帮助团队了解项目进展和绩效。

结论

项目化管理的模式多种多样,每种模式都有其独特的特点和适用场景。选择合适的项目管理模式和工具,能够帮助团队高效管理项目,提高项目成功率。在选择项目管理系统时,可以根据项目特点和团队需求,选择合适的系统,如研发项目管理系统PingCode和通用项目管理软件Worktile,以优化项目管理效果。

相关问答FAQs:

1. 项目化管理的模式有哪些?
项目化管理的模式有敏捷项目管理、传统项目管理和混合项目管理等几种模式。敏捷项目管理强调团队协作、快速适应变化和持续交付价值;传统项目管理注重规划、执行和控制项目进程;混合项目管理则结合了敏捷和传统的方法,根据具体项目需求灵活选择适合的管理方式。

2. 如何选择适合的项目化管理模式?
选择适合的项目化管理模式要根据项目的特点和需求进行评估。如果项目需求变化频繁,团队成员具备高度协作能力,可以考虑采用敏捷项目管理;如果项目需求较稳定,需要明确的计划和控制,可以选择传统项目管理;如果项目需求具有一定的不确定性,可以采用混合项目管理的方式,根据具体情况灵活调整管理方法。

3. 项目化管理模式之间有何区别?
敏捷项目管理与传统项目管理在方法论、团队协作、需求变更等方面存在明显区别。敏捷项目管理注重迭代开发、持续反馈和自组织团队,强调快速交付可用的产品;传统项目管理则更注重规划、执行和控制,强调项目目标的达成。混合项目管理则结合了两者的优点,根据项目的实际情况灵活调整管理方式。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/663848

(0)
Edit1Edit1
上一篇 2024年8月21日 下午2:54
下一篇 2024年8月21日 下午2:54
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部